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08595780 76058081180 89547929
37328804477 1573
37328804477 1573
773286087 2128 0908188945 64
All about undefined
Interested in learning more?
37328804477 1573
773286087 2128 0908188945 64
See more
42977067 215032908
624 5921399 414
See more
7075357 6839
19653195 6975 282 5486 5748857654
See more